Understanding Your AML Report: Key Metrics Explained
Deciphering your Anti-Money Laundering ( Financial Crime Prevention) report can feel challenging , but understanding the vital metrics is key for compliance . This analysis typically includes several metrics highlighting potential dangers . Specifically, pay close attention to the Transaction Volume Anomaly : this shows unexpected spikes or dips in activity. Suspicious Activity Report ( Unusual Activity Report) counts represent the number of transactions flagged for deeper investigation. Also, note the Customer Risk Rating ; a higher number may indicate a greater need for enhanced due diligence. Finally, monitor your False Positive Frequency to improve your detection rules and reduce operational costs. Comprehending these central details empowers you to proactively manage your AML strategy and mitigate financial crime risk .

Demystifying AML Reports: What Do the Numbers Mean?
Understanding AML filings can feel like cracking a complex code. Several individuals find it difficult with the information presented, wondering what the multiple numbers really signify. Essentially, these figures indicate a pattern of activity flagged by the system internal monitoring processes. A increased number doesn't automatically mean illegal activity is taking place; website it signifies that a transaction demands further scrutiny by a experienced financial professional to determine its authenticity. Consequently, accurate evaluation and perspective are essential to preventing unnecessary investigations and protecting legal adherence.
